Output efd4e950052688ed7936c98c51516990a7de4e15b1cd2972ba9d6cc89e68441d:0

value
44508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8766f931d57b022b4c424aa84aac9636352023cb OP_EQUAL
address
3E2xWAC59vUFSwoegELFF4dzAR7YzYX8rw
transaction
efd4e950052688ed7936c98c51516990a7de4e15b1cd2972ba9d6cc89e68441d
spent
true